Summary
SERRUM was established to improve COVID-19 vaccination efficiency in the Caribbean, specifically noted through Anguilla's recovery results. The initiative facilitated a transparent vaccination process, achieving over 75% vaccination of eligible Anguillians within seven weeks. Additionally, SERRUM supplied the government with resources such as devices and internet access at no charge. Its Vaccine Passport Module identifies vaccinated individuals, crucial for safe travel and the resumption of business in a tourism-reliant economy. Moreover, the initiative included a Data Analytics Dashboard to aid informed decision-making. Future plans entail vaccinating minors, bolstering contact tracing efforts, and creating a regional vaccine passport (CARIPASS) to ease travel across the Caribbean.
